I Just Won’t Play by the Book

Chapter 506: Forge sword

"How do you feel."

Seeing Gu Qinghuan recovering slightly, Jiang Beiran asked.

"Return to senior brother, there is no discomfort." Gu Qinghuan raised his right arm after speaking, "but I can still feel the aura flowing in my body."

"Can you control it."

"Please allow me to give it a try." After Gu Qinghuan finished speaking, he transported the True Yuan Tiangang Jue.

After a while, Gu Qinghuan opened his eyes and said, "No problem, I can control this profound energy."

After thinking for a while, Jiang Beiran asked again: "Has all auras become profound energy?"

"Yes." Gu Qinghuan nodded, "Although it feels a little different, they have indeed become profound energy."

"You try to turn it into aura again."

"Yes."

In response, Gu Qinghuan once again transported the True Yuan Tiangang Jue, and released the powerful profound energy in his body back to spiritual energy. The process was much simpler than he had imagined.

Seeing the [Emperor Aura] released by Gu Qinghuan condensed into a purple cloud again, Jiang Beiran was sure that there should be no problem in letting him infuse [Emperor Aura] into [Shajue].

As for the [Emperor Aura] itself... Jiang Beiran intends to let Gu Qinghuan go to the self enchantment again to see if he can use the previous "perpetual motion machine" method to fill the entire ego enchantment with Emperor Aura.

But these are all things later, and the immediate problem is still to cast this [Shajue] first.

Now that the main materials and [Emperor Reiki] have been prepared, the rest is the casting process.

Jiang Beiran is naturally also a master in terms of refining tools, but the materials used in this [Shou Jue] are obviously too high-end, even surpassing the top treasures on the rare spectrum.

This level of treasure has never even been obtained in Jiangbei, let alone forged.

So he has no confidence in whether he can succeed once, but if he cannot succeed once, he has no material to do the second time.

Picking up the [Shajue] forging book again, Jiang Beiran carefully read it and decided to forge it directly.

Because for the craftsman, creating a brand new weapon is the most difficult.

From the selection of materials to the design, from the method of construction to the inlay of treasures...

It takes absolute talent and unpredictable hard work to make a peerless magic weapon come to life.

But [Shajue] is a magic weapon that has been created. Simply put, everything about it has been designed and perfected, and it is recorded in the forging book.

In this way, the difficulty is greatly reduced. All Jiang Beiran needs to do is to draw a gourd according to the pattern, and perfect the operation described in the forging book.

Compared to creating a brand-new magic weapon by yourself, it is not difficult to build a magic weapon according to the blueprint.

"Sorry, Brother Wang... Have I rested for too long."

At this moment, Li Fucheng suddenly walked out of Feifu and said.

Looking at Li Fucheng who was still a little weak, Jiang Beiran said, "Go back and rest for a while."

"Can……"

"The next thing we have to face will only be more difficult. I need you to recharge and prepare well now."

"Yes!" Li Fucheng agreed, and was sent back to the Fei Mansion by Shi Fenglan.

After this episode, Jiang Beiran looked at Gu Qinghuan again and said, "Come with me."

"Yes."

Bringing Gu Qinghuan to the forging platform, Jiang Beiran picked up the glass ingot and beat it twice. After repeatedly determining its strength, Jiang Beiran started forging.

Burning, heating, folding and forging, clamping steel...

After a series of skilled operations, the blade has slowly taken shape, and the next step is a very critical step, forging the blade.

This step requires not only beating, but also to feel the best force direction of the material.

Under Jiang Beiran's guidance, apart from practicing Zhenyuan Tiangang Jue, what Gu Qinghuan does the most is refining tools.

After a few years, he also felt that he had a slight success in refining tools.

But after seeing his senior's forging technique, he knew that he was still far behind. Each hammer seemed simple and rude, but in fact it was full of details.

Every hammer of the brother can be said to be extremely accurate, and it is fast and accurate, so that Gu Qinghuan even feels a little dizzy.

After repeatedly beating the blade, Jiang Beiran began the next steps.

Cool down, trim the thickness, heat the sword embryo again, sprinkle with black feather powder, and then quench it with Jinghong Lingquan.

Because he has kept the steps in the forging book in mind, Jiang Beiran's whole set of movements was completed in one go, creating the sword body of [Shoujue].

The ordinary magic weapon will come to an end at this point, and all that is left is to hit the blade and install the hilt.

But [Shajue] is obviously not an ordinary magic weapon, and the completion of the sword body is only half of it.

Next, Jiang Beiran needed to engrave a formation from the forging book on the sword body.

And this is the essence of the colored glaze ingot.

According to the description in the forging book, the role of the colored glaze ingot is to multiply the effect of the formation. As for how much it can magnify, it all depends on the skill of the sword holder.

To put it simply, what kind of formation is engraved on the sword, and what effect it will play.

For example, if you engrave a reconnaissance-type formation on it, it can sense everything around you. If you engrave a defensive-type formation, it can protect you.

Proper array effect amplifier.

When it used to be the form of Zhanriluu, it was able to block sunlight because it was engraved with a dark environment-like formation.

But... Jiang Beiran didn't recognize this formation in the forging book.

Although he was able to engrave the formation on the sword body according to the layout method detailed in the book, he didn't know what effect it would exert, and he didn't even have a direction to guess.

This formation is too biased from the layout to the formation, and even a bit evil.

Jiang Beiran even wondered if he would build an evil sword.

‘Evil is evil, as long as it can be used. ’

With this thought in mind, Jiang Beiran began to engrave the formation on the sword.

Although Gu Qinghuan on the side didn’t understand the formation technique, he still looked at it very seriously. In fact, he had long been interested in the mysterious art of formation technique, but he was too busy on weekdays, and he had to take care of both cultivation and refinement. Can't tell the mind to give a more complicated formation.

After all, not everyone can have an exquisite heart like the brother, who knows everything and is good at everything.

Thinking of this, Gu Qinghuan admired the brother even more.

It is a **** and man in the world!

...

An hour later, Jiang Beiran successfully engraved the formation on the sword. This step unexpectedly consumed a lot of his energy.

One is that he is not familiar with this formation, and the other is that carving the formation on the glass ingot is not as easy as he imagined. A little carelessness may cause damage to the sword itself.

But no matter how troublesome it is, it's all done.

Putting the sword aside, Jiang Beiran's next thing to build is the hilt.

In the eyes of most people, the hilt is not so important, even as an ornament.

But in the hands of a real master craftsman, the hilt is also a very important part of the entire sword, and its quality will directly determine the sword holder's ability to exert the strength of the sword.
